Taylor Swift is reportedly “done” with her former BFF Blake Lively and is “ignoring” all attempts at contact after being dragged into the actress’ legal war with Justin Baldoni.

A source told the Daily Mail that the It Ends With Us star’s “grovelling” calls, texts and emails have all gone unanswered, despite the pair’s decade-long friendship – and the fact that Swift is even godmother to Lively’s children with Ryan Reynolds.

“Even though Taylor has totally cut ties with her, Blake hasn’t with Taylor,” the insider claimed.

“She’s been reaching out to her with texts, voicemails and even emails begging to mend what they once had. Blake isn’t giving up on trying to get her friendship with Taylor back on track.

“Taylor hasn’t responded to any of Blake’s pleas. She’s ignored all her grovelling excuses. The missives explain there must be some misunderstanding on Taylor’s part and that she would never do anything to harm their ten years of closeness and personal secrets.”

The source added that Swift feels “betrayed” and “exploited” by Lively.

“Taylor obviously still means so much to Blake, but Taylor’s totally done with her and as of right now, no requests will mend their bond as far as she’s concerned,” they said.

The once-close friendship reportedly came to an abrupt halt in May after the Cruel Summer singer was subpoaned as a witness by Baldoni’s legal team in his ongoing It Ends With Us legal battle with Lively.

At the time, a source close to Swift told People magazine that she had “halted” her relationship with the Gossip Girl star: “Taylor wants no part in this drama.”

Baldoni’s legal team subsequently withdrew the subpoena after Swift denied any involvement in the saga.

“Taylor Swift never set foot on the set of this movie, she was not involved in any casting or creative decisions, she did not score the film, she never saw an edit or made any notes on the film, she did not even see ‘It Ends With Us’ until weeks after its public release, and was travelling around the globe during 2023 and 2024 headlining the biggest tour in history,” her representative said, in response to the subpoena.

The inclusion of Swift in the court battle in May added even more attention to the high-profile battle between Lively and Baldoni, which began in December when Lively filed a lawsuit against Baldoni for emotional distress and lost wages.

A month later, Baldoni returned serve, suing Lively – as well as Reynolds – for US$400 million ($A623 million).

Baldoni then claimed Lively had weaponised her friendship with Swift to try and leverage creative control of their film, which he was directing.

At the time, Page Six reported that his complaint referenced how one of Lively’s “famous, and famously close” friends had been at her and Reynolds’ NYC home when he was invited over one evening.

He claimed that the celebrity in question had praised Lively’s script rewrites to him, referencing the “rooftop scene” where the main characters first meet.

“I really love what you did. It really does help a lot,” Baldoni wrote in a text written about their meeting.

“Makes it so much more fun and interesting. (And I would have felt that way without Ryan or Taylor).”

Lively then responded, calling Swift and Reynolds her “creative barometers” and “dragons”.

“The message could not have been clearer. Baldoni was not just dealing with Lively. He was also facing Lively’s ‘dragons,’ two of the most influential and wealthy celebrities in the world, who were not afraid to make things very difficult for him,” Baldoni’s lawyer, Bryan Freedman, alleged.

However, a source close to Swift told the Daily Mail that she had no involvement, and had arrived at her friend’s home to find the meeting already underway.

Both Lively and Baldoni have denied all accusations against them and their legal trial is set for March 2026.

Meanwhile, court documents obtained by Page Six this week showed that Lively has requested to withdraw claims that she suffered from an “intentional infliction of emotional distress” and “negligent infliction of emotional distress” as a result of Baldoni’s alleged misconduct.

The filing followed Baldoni’s legal team requesting she sign a release form so they could access her medical and mental health records, arguing that they were vital to her “emotional distress” allegations.

The court will now determine if Lively’s request will be approved.
